Cammy Frei

Cammy Frei

  • Class:
    Sophomore
  • High School:
    New Trier HS
  • Hometown:
    Winnetka, Ill.
2020 SPRING SEASON
Picked up an 8-4 spring season singles record • Went 6-5 in doubles on the year • Defeated opponents from Wisconsin, Mizzou, Rutgers and Memphis with partner Tina Kreinis •  Went on to win four straight singles matches after falling to a #108 ranked UCLA opponent • Won her match over No. 21 Wisconsin’s Miruna Tudor 6-4, 5-7, 6-4 to clinch the Border Battle victory for the Gophers  • Named Big Ten Athlete of the Week on March 10 for her win over Wisconsin.

2019 FALL SEASON
Had a clean singles record of 3-0 at the Gopher Invitational • Overall, was 8-1 with five doubles wins •  Beat Nebraska Omaha’s Ines Absisan 6-2, 6-1 at the ITA Central Regional • Went undefeated with three singles wins at the FGCU Invitational • Ended the Fall season with a record of 13-4.

2019 SPRING SEASON
Opened up play by leaving a doubles match unfinished 3-3 against #8 UCLA • Continued early spring action with a dominating 6-2 doubles win over #41 Florida International with partner, Caitlyn Merzbacher • Started singles with a 4-0 record including wins against Montana, DePaul, South Dakota, and Northern Iowa opponents • Downed Iowa State’s Ekaterina Repina in a 5-7, 6-3, 7-6 (7-0) tilt • Kicked off conference matches with back-to-back singles wins against Rutgers and Maryland • Pulled off three consecutive doubles victories including a huge 6-4 win against Iowa State’s top duo • Saw a majority of play out of the No. 4 singles position as well as playing out of the top doubles combination with Merzbacher throughout the regular season.

2018 FALL SEASON
Played alongside River Hart to win her first doubles match of the fall season 6-4 against Ohio State’s duo of Emma DeCoste and Andrea Ballinger during the Notre Dame Invitational • Won against Ohio State’s Ballinger in a 7-6 (10-8), 6-0 battle to secure her first singles win of the fall • Additionally saw doubles action with Camila Vargas.

2018 SPRING SEASON
Went 13-5 in singles play and 7-3 in doubles • Finished the season 12-5 from the No. 6 position in singles • Ended the season playing some of her best tennis, ending the season on a four-match winning streak • Finished 5-3 in the No. 3 doubles position and 2-0 in the No. 2 slot • Finished with an 8-3 record vs. Big Ten opponents, putting her career record at 9-4 • Started season 6-0 in the No. 5 and No. 6 position, including starting the Big Ten season with a win over Wisconsin that helped the Gophers win the dual 4-3 • Helped the Gophers defeated Iowa 4-3 on the road with a straight sets win over Danielle Burch, 6-0, 6-3 • Aided in the doubles point against Iowa with partner River Hart, winning their No. 3 doubles match 6-4.

2017 SPRING SEASON
Went 4-1 in singles play and 10-10 in doubles • Was most successful in the No. 2 slot, going 8-4 with all of those games being played with partner Ryba • Played all singles matches from the No. 6 position • Started spring season strong with a 6-1, 6-0 singles victory against South Dakota State • Picked up first singles B1G victory with a 6-4, 6-3 victory over Caitlin Calkins of Purdue • Opened spring season with Ryba as the No. 1 doubles pair • With partner Ryba, contributed a point against No. 24 Mississippi with a 6-3 victory • Won exciting match against No. 9 Michigan 7-6 (7-4) in the No. 3 doubles match. 

2016 FALL SEASON
Went 9-6 in singles play and 16-6 in doubles • Picked up her first collegiate victory over Astrid Santos 6-4, 7-5 at the Gopher Invitational • Won seven doubles matches at the Gopher Invitational • Won two more singles matches and four more doubles matches at the FGCU Fall Tournament • Picked up four doubles victories at the ITA Central Region Championships with Caroline Ryba • Finished the fall season with a victory at the Kitty Harrison Invite.

HIGH SCHOOL
Four year varsity letter winner at New Tier High School • Was named All-Conference all four years • Earned All-State honors three times • Placed third in the state doubles tournament her sophomore year • Took seventh place at the state tournament in singles her senior year while winning regionals • Was on the Honor Roll all four years and in 2015-16 was a state scholar.

PERSONAL
Proposed major in Industrial & Systems Engineering • Lists most memorable sports thrill as placing third in the state doubles tournament her sophomore year • Was a scholar-athlete 2015-2016 • Enjoys taking her dogs to the beach and listening to music • Daughter of Debbie and Bob Frei • Has two sisters, Kaitlin and Lauren • Her sister Kaitlin, ran track and cross country at Notre Dame and her father, Bob, played tennis at Princeton.
